摘要
While animal welfare concerns are rising globally, this has not been the case with lower- and middle-income economies in Africa and Asia such as Zimbabwe. These developing countries have their own problems which are not reported in developed countries, such as the harsh economic environment, limited technologies and different political and food security priorities. These factors limit focusing on animal welfare. Meanwhile, studies on animal welfare in these countries have been limited. The task of determining animal welfare is a very complex and can sometimes be very subjective since there is no gold standard protocol to be used in many developing countries. This paper reviews the main factors that are used to assess dairy animal welfare at a farm situation. The factors were categorised and generally discussed as drivers and indicators of dairy animal welfare. Key indicators reviewed in this study include but are not limited to production performance indicators, body condition scores, cleanliness scores, presence of clinical disease signs and physiological and behavioural indicators. Dairy animal welfare drivers discussed in this paper include but not limited to the general design of dairy cattle housing, presence of foot bath and shading facilities, presence and use of maternity paddocks, state of feeder and water troughs.
